First edition, first printing. Signed by James Booth. Publisher's original black cloth with gilt titles to the spine, in dustwrapper. A fine copy, the binding square and tight, the contents clean throughout and without previous owner;s marks. Complete with the fine original dustwrapper that remains without fading, loss or tears.
Signed by James Booth in pencil on the title page. A collection of essays on Philip Larkin, edited by James Booth, former Professor of English at the University of Hull and biographer, editor and colleague of Philip Larkin.
